Understanding Self-Emptying TechnologyWhat is a Self-Emptying Robot Vacuum and Mop?
A self-Emptying Robot Vacuum (myspace.com) and mop is an automatic cleaning device that can autonomously collect dirt, dust, and particles, shop it briefly in a base station, and deal with it later on. Unlike conventional robot vacuums which require manual emptying, these innovative devices help automate the cleaning process even more by eliminating the requirement for frequent interventions.
How Does It Work?
The self-emptying procedure usually involves the following actions:
Cleaning: The robot performs its typical vacuuming or mopping jobs.Docking: Once its battery is low or it has actually finished cleaning, the robot returns to its base station.Emptying: The base station includes a vacuum inlet that produces suction to move the gathered debris from the robot's dustbin into a bigger dust bag or bin.Alert: Users receive a notice when the dust bag is full and requires to be changed.A Quick Comparison of Self-Emptying Models

How frequently do I require to empty the dust bag in the base station?
The frequency of emptying the dust bag depends upon aspects like your home's cleanliness, variety of family pets, and the capability of the bag. Many bags can last numerous weeks to a number of months before needing replacement.
2. Can robot vacuums and mops manage pet hair effectively?
Yes, lots of designs are developed particularly to get pet hair with specialized brush systems and powerful suction abilities.
3. Is self-emptying innovation noisy?
The self-emptying procedure does generate sound, however it is normally much less noisy than traditional vacuum. Designs differ, so reviewing decibel scores can give insight into sound levels.
4. Can I control my robot vacuum and mop from another location?
A lot of modern self-emptying robots support mobile phone apps, enabling you to control cleaning schedules, screen cleaning development, and receive notifications from anywhere.
5. What upkeep do self-emptying vacuums need beyond dust bag replacement?
Frequently check and clean the brushes, sensing units, and wheels. Some designs also require periodic replacement of the mop fabric or pad.
